Scandinavian countries typically include Denmark, Norway, and Sweden, known for their distinct cultures and landscapes. A map of this region highlights Denmark's flat terrain and coastal areas, Norway's rugged mountains and fjords, and Sweden's vast forests and lakes. The geographical proximity and historical ties among these countries contribute to their shared cultural heritage. Additionally, Finland and Iceland are often associated with the broader Nordic region, though they are not considered part of Scandinavia itself.
